Home > Candids > 2020 > On the set of 'Tick Tick...Boom!" in East Village, New York - October 27th
image5.jpg
image2.jpg image3.jpg image4.jpg image5.jpg image5~0.jpg
Rate this file (No vote yet)
Theme & design by STEFY